阿里云物联网平台快速入门实践

物联网平台提供了物联设备上云的服务,无需自建物联网的基础设施即可便捷地接入和管理设备。具有低成本、高可靠、高性能、易运维的优势,强大的数据处理能力可以更好地对设备数据进行分析和可视化展示,实时的安全威胁检测可以保证每个实例都是安全可靠的,是每个企业设备上云的首选。

1、开发者登入账号

开发者前往企业物联网平台,从下图中可以看到新用户可以免费试用,首先完成注册或者登录。

image.png

接着直接点击下图的管理控制台。

image.png

如果开发者之前已经购买过或者只是试用,可以直接跳到第三步创建产品。

而有些开发者购买了HaaS开发板,已经获得了赠送的1年免费套餐包,可进入第二步查看充值的资源包

如购买了HaaS板还未领取套餐包,可在HaaS开发者群中联系HaaS小二 - 风裁 领取)。

2、查看已充值(赠送)的资源包

从点击管理控制台进来后,点击费用,如下图所示:

image.png

在左下角有提货券管理,点击,如下图所示:

image.png

进入提货券管理,点击详情项,进入提货券详情页面,如下图所示:

image.png

点击立即开通,如下图所示,资源包已经成功开通。

image.png

前往订单列表,如果出现物联网小规格套餐包说明已经充值成功,如下图所示:

image.png

3、创建产品与设备

使用物联网平台的第一步是在云端创建产品和对应设备,获取设备证书(ProductKey、DeviceName和DeviceSecret)。

  • 产品相当于一类设备的集合,同一产品下的设备具有相同的功能。您可以根据产品批量管理设备,如定义物模型、自定义Topic等。
  • 您的每个实际设备需对应一个物联网平台设备。将物联网平台颁发的设备证书(ProductKey、DeviceName和DeviceSecret)烧录到设备上,用于设备连接物联网平台的身份验证。

3.1、创建产品

首先点击“公共实例”

image.png

在左侧导航栏,选择设备管理产品,创建产品

image.png

再配置参数,完成后点击确认。

image.png

3.2、添加设备

点击“添加设备”为新创建的产品添加一个全新的设备。

image.png

可以批量添加,也可以添加单个设备,这里点击下图中的“添加设备”来添加单个设备,

image.png

输入DeviceName和备注名称,点确认就可以

image.png

在下图中点击“完成”。

image.png

至此产品和设备就已经创建成功了,可以点击查看就能获取设备证书。

image.png

设备证书包含ProductKey、DeviceName和DeviceSecret。设备证书是设备后续与物联网平台交流的重要凭证,请妥善保管。

image.png

3.3、为产品定义物模型

物联网平台支持为产品定义物模型,将实际产品抽象成由属性、服务、事件所组成的数据模型,便于云端管理和数据交互。产品创建完成后,您可以为它定义物模型,产品下的设备将自动继承物模型内容。

在左侧导航栏,选择设备管理产品。在产品列表中,找到已创建的产品,单击操作栏的查看

image.png

在产品详情页,单击功能定义页签,然后单击编辑草稿

image.png

功能定义页面,单击添加自定义功能,进行物模型配置,然后单击确认

重复此步骤的操作,完成如下属性、服务、事件配置

image.png

添加完成后,单击物模型TSL,在完整物模型栏下,可看到该产品的完整物模型JSON文件,并且可以导出。

image.png

另外除了前面在功能定义页面,单击添加自定义功能,一步一步配置外,也可以点击“快速导入”来导入模型文件,

image.png

比如导入一个HaaSFlower.TSL.json的模型文件。

之后再点击发布。

image.png

至此物联网平台上的操作就结束了,后续就需要关注如何建立设备与平台的连接。

可以参考示例:

基于HaaS100快速搭建智能家居应用

一步步打造能手机远程管理的HaaS花卉养植系统

实战HaaS100搭载4G模组连接阿里云物联网

4、参考资料

阿里云物联网平台公共实例快速入门

https://help.aliyun.com/document_detail/131611.html?spm=a2c4g.11186623.6.571.29477e66YtjVwj

若有收获,就点个赞吧

5、开发者技术支持

如需更多技术支持,可加入钉钉开发者群

更多技术与解决方案介绍,请访问阿里云AIoT首页https://iot.aliyun.com/

猜你喜欢

转载自blog.csdn.net/HaaSTech/article/details/111190159